Output 3c12e77fb23e5997a9bd7081c3a61f622c5a22f56bcc3ebd00ccfcf5446723c4:21

value
15158518
script pubkey
OP_0 OP_PUSHBYTES_20 dc8268dd4b8f0bd093a0f6bb49a7028f2b6fc596
address
bc1qmjpx3h2t3u9apyaq76a5nfcz3u4kl3vkj426vp
transaction
3c12e77fb23e5997a9bd7081c3a61f622c5a22f56bcc3ebd00ccfcf5446723c4
spent
false

15 Sat Ranges